简介
随着前端开发技术的不断发展,选择一个合适的框架和开发环境对于提高开发效率至关重要。Umi 是一个基于 React 的轻量级框架,但同时也支持 Vue。本文将为您详细介绍如何在 Vue 项目中快速集成 Umi 框架,搭建一个高效的开发环境。
准备工作
在开始之前,请确保您已经安装了以下工具:
创建 Vue 项目
- 使用 Vue CLI 创建一个新的 Vue 项目:
vue create my-vue-project
- 选择合适的配置项,例如选择“Manually select features”(手动选择功能),确保选择“Babel”和“Router”。
安装 Umi
在您的 Vue 项目根目录下,使用 npm 或 yarn 安装 Umi:
npm install umi --save-dev
# 或者
yarn add umi --dev
配置 Umi
- 在项目根目录下创建或编辑
package.json文件,添加一个umi脚本:
"scripts": {
"start": "umi start",
"build": "umi build",
"test": "umi test"
}
- 在项目根目录下创建一个名为
.umirc.js的配置文件,配置 Umi 相关参数:
// .umirc.js
export default {
routes: [
{
path: '/',
component: '../src/pages/index',
},
],
// 其他配置...
};
开发与调试
使用
npm run start或yarn start命令启动项目,Umi 将会启动一个开发服务器,并打开浏览器预览。在
.umirc.js文件中配置publicPath可以修改静态资源的引用路径。使用
npm run build或yarn build命令进行项目构建,生成生产环境下的静态资源。
插件与扩展
Umi 提供了丰富的插件和扩展机制,您可以根据实际需求进行选择和配置。以下是一些常用的插件:
- dva:一个基于 Redux 的数据流框架,用于构建复杂的应用。
- umi-plugin-react:React 特定的插件,提供了一些 React 相关的功能。
总结
通过以上步骤,您就可以在 Vue 项目中快速集成 Umi 框架,搭建一个高效的开发环境。Umi 提供了丰富的功能和扩展,可以帮助您更轻松地开发前端项目。希望本文能对您有所帮助。
